Herb Ginkgo (Ginkgo biloba)
Ginkgo biloba, also known as the maidenhair tree, is the most ancient and one of the longest surviving plants on earth. Herb Lemon Balm (Melissa officinalis)
Lemon balm, balm or Melissa is an aromatic plant that originates from southern Europe, but now grows freely all over the world. Herb Hops (Humulus lupulus)
The Hops plant is native to Europe, Asia and North America. This climbing plant is well known for its use in the brewing industry as the Hops are using for flavouring beer. Herb Rosemary (Rosmarinus officinalis)
This small, aromatic, evergreen shrubby plant is native to the Mediterranean region and now cultivated world-wide. It has been used for thousands of years to improve memory and aid digestion, and as a preservative for meats. Herb Bitter orange (Citrus aurantium)
Citrus aurantium is also known as bitter orange, green orange or sour orange. In traditional Chinese Medicine it is known as zhi shi and in Aromatherapy the essential oil is called neroli. Herb Vetiver (Vetiveria zizanoides)
Vetiver or vetivert is a tall, tufted perennial scented grass. It is native to Sri Lanka, Indonesia and southern India. It is cultivated all over the world for its volatile oil, which is mainly used in aromatherapy. Herb Lemongrass (Cymbopogon citratus)
This is a fast growing, tall perennial grass which is native to Asia. There are two types – East Indian and West Indian, both being widely used in cooking, aromatherapy and medicine. Herb Neroli (Citrus aurantium flos)
Neroli or orange blossom is the flowers of the plant, bitter orange (Citrus aurantium). Neroli is the name of the essential oil that is mainly used for aromatherapy, rather than in herbal medicine. Herb White pot herb (Valerianella locusta)
Corn salad, mache, lamb’s lettuce, field salad and field lettuce are all names for a salad green of the valerian family.
